Type
ORACLE
Validation date
2023-12-19 07:39: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04158,
    "usd": 0.04544
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00019D44C2D30CD6019756EB155EB079F8AEB737E30DA8F07A9842C4EA4EAD484AFC

Previous signature

AF5DF5E97F49EB7A222885801BA760A0B7744FA43651BC76046378337F8B56F5D24B01E478674B99A418D349267451D93778932E8936A7F2A78C5D5C4368F200

Origin signature

304502205ECCBA4C697813DFF5DAED9197B15DA271C589A15F92C975C6ED9EAC97D00BD602210086123FA4A83C9F18A4869CD9EE15BFAA6E50586973898E2DC4CFFC9004A5647D

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

006A719CA45E1A39E683AC98AD7AC02CC89B0D4356E653F8C3ED8E549AC3F7A0ED

Coordinator signature

39E6F582E3A121D3047CC3D213D3671C4AD50E519A0E5ED928A466FA73A82CA18ED8B9C9899E2D2EA08224270EC60CECB24A36396B00B8F70236B3A080C18D03

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

AE25747E46AC4C0FFC53760C6053A74AC9BD26B0839336869FF33CDA2D677B4DA400D26724125E0589986FFF9B4B489339D353686A4A06B9DCEB1F33DFB3410A

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

85070BD7BB047FBDF1B5029C95144914157C10EB206B3D60F814DE2CBFC2802795061F2A3BA2202DA995E70987B7B704C2F822FED64027037976A241961FFE0E